How can lifecycle analysis identify inefficiencies in sustainable production?
Lifecycle analysis (LCA) is a method of evaluating the environmental impacts of a product or service throughout its entire lifespan, from raw materials to disposal or recycling. By applying LCA to sustainable production, you can identify and reduce inefficiencies, waste, and emissions, and improve your environmental performance and competitiveness.
